Important Ideas for 6-Wire Trailer Wiring
Correct trailer wiring is essential for security and performance. The following pointers present steerage for guaranteeing a dependable and compliant electrical connection between towing automobile and trailer.
Tip 1: Seek the advice of the Trailer’s Wiring Diagram: By no means assume wire colours conform to the usual. At all times seek the advice of the trailer’s particular wiring diagram for definitive shade assignments and keep away from potential mismatches.
Tip 2: Use Marine-Grade Wiring and Connectors: Marine-grade elements supply superior corrosion resistance, essential for enduring publicity to the weather. That is significantly necessary for boat trailers or trailers steadily uncovered to moisture.
Tip 3: Safe and Shield Wiring Harnesses: Unfastened wiring can chafe towards the trailer body, resulting in shorts or full circuit failure. Use zip ties or mounting clips to safe the harness and shield it from abrasion. Wire loom supplies further safety towards harm.
Tip 4: Apply Dielectric Grease to Connections: Dielectric grease inhibits corrosion and ensures dependable electrical contact. Making use of a small quantity to every connection earlier than mating plug and socket prolongs connector lifespan and maintains conductivity.
Tip 5: Make use of Warmth Shrink Tubing for Splices and Repairs: Warmth shrink tubing supplies a water-resistant and insulated seal for splices and repairs, guaranteeing lasting safety towards environmental elements and mechanical stress.
Tip 6: Confirm Floor Connection Integrity: A strong floor connection is paramount for all circuit performance. Periodically examine and clear floor connections to stop corrosion and preserve optimum electrical conductivity. This minimizes the danger of ground-related malfunctions.
Tip 7: Take a look at All Features After Set up: After finishing the wiring course of, take a look at all lights and electrical capabilities to make sure correct operation. This consists of brake lights, flip indicators, working lights, reverse lights, and any auxiliary circuits. Systematic testing confirms right wiring and identifies potential points early on.
Tip 8: Think about Skilled Set up for Advanced Methods: For trailers with advanced wiring necessities or built-in braking techniques, skilled set up by a professional technician ensures correct configuration, minimizes danger, and supplies peace of thoughts.
